Thomas Rowlandson (1756-1827)
Hug Mug Gin

Signed lower right:
Rowlandson Del., inscribed lower left: Sketch'd at R H... and indistinctly lower centre: The ..... and the ....
Pen and grey ink and watercolour over pencil
27 by 21.1 cm., 10 ½ by 8 ¼ in.

Engraved:
As an etching by Rowlandson, 1815

A similar print after Rowlandson,with a different background, was published by Thomas Tegg in 1813 as `Batchelor's Fare - Bread, Cheese and Kisses' (see Joseph Grego,
Rowlandson the Caricaturist - a Selection of his Works, 1880, vol. II, p.253, ill.). Copies of the 1815 etching are in the Metropolitan Museum of Art, New York and the Fine Arts Museum of San Francisco.
